Neighborhood Overview
Archbishop Hoban High School is situated on the east side of Akron, Ohio, nestled within a well-established residential and community area. The campus is easily accessible via major roadways, primarily I-77 and the Ohio Turnpike (I-80/I-76), making it a convenient destination for travelers from across the state and beyond. Parking is available directly on campus, with specific lots designated for athletic events and general school functions. For those arriving by air, Akron-Canton Airport (CAK) is the closest option, located just a short drive south of the city. Cleveland Hopkins International Airport (CLE) is also a viable alternative, though it requires a longer drive north. Public transportation options are somewhat limited in this area for direct campus access, so driving or utilizing rideshare services are generally the most efficient ways to reach Hoban. Planning your arrival to account for potential local traffic, especially during peak school pick-up times or around major sporting events, is always a good strategy.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winter in Akron is cold, with average temperatures frequently dipping below freezing. Expect snowfall, which can range from light dustings to significant accumulations, potentially impacting travel and outdoor event conditions. Visitors should pack heavy winter coats, gloves, hats, and waterproof footwear to stay warm and dry. Events held during this season may be subject to delays or cancellations due to severe weather, so checking forecasts and event status is crucial.
Spring & early summer
Spring brings a gradual warming trend but can be quite variable, with cool days interspersed with mild to warm weather. Rain is common, so packing a light, waterproof jacket or umbrella is advisable. Early summer continues this mild pattern before the heat sets in. Outdoor activities become more comfortable, but it's wise to be prepared for changing conditions, especially during transitional months. Layers are key for fluctuating temperatures.
Mid-summer
Mid-summer typically brings the warmest weather to Akron, with average temperatures often in the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it, occasionally reaching into the 90s. Humidity can also be a factor, making it feel warmer. Visitors should prioritize lightweight clothing, sun protection like hats and sunscreen, and stay hydrated, especially if attending outdoor events. Clear skies are common, but pop-up thunderstorms can occur in the late afternoon.
Fall season
Fall offers some of the most pleasant weather in Akron, with crisp air and temperatures gradually cooling from mild to chilly. This season is ideal for outdoor sports and activities, with beautiful autumn foliage often enhancing the scenery. Visitors may need a light jacket or sweater for cooler mornings and evenings, while warmer afternoons might still allow for short sleeves. The weather is generally stable but can turn colder by late October and November.
Rain & snow
Akron experiences a mix of rain and snow throughout the year, with the heaviest precipitation typically occurring in spring and fall. Winter months are prone to snow, while summer can bring thunderstorms. Visitors should always check the local forecast close to their travel dates. Having waterproof outerwear and appropriate footwear is a practical measure for navigating any weather, ensuring comfort and safety during your visit regardless of the conditions.
